Output 668ad9402d0e124768e5852b9ef536a1c0004de09996197a7947c8b1778a2b02:0

value
47344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5069b22b4306342b3e33a6e21ae0d42e1743c2fe OP_EQUAL
address
392CbmujLro6FpA3dgkcg47JFJPoqj1ev2
transaction
668ad9402d0e124768e5852b9ef536a1c0004de09996197a7947c8b1778a2b02
confirmations
209629
spent
true